ABSTRACT

Care of the patient with a presumed life- or limb-threatening lower extremity wound poses many challenges. The mindset regarding potential outcomes of such conditions is mostly driven by the experiences and expertise of those providing the care. This mindset generally appears as two primary actions presented to the afflicted patient: attempted resolution of the problem via medical, surgical or combination treatment, with the hope of low recurrence risk, or exacerbation and amputation-amputations at a level sufficient to, at least in the mind of the surgeon, eliminate the problem. Achieving the former outcome is dependent on a number of factors associated with both patient and caregiver. If healing is achieved, the secondary goal of prevention of recurrence may be no less arduous, with failure most likely resulting in amputation. Clearly, these considerations appear to be based more on the health professionals perception, of the patient's physical and medical status rather than on patient-centred considerations. This article will review considerations and recommendations for lower extremity amputation, and the short- and long-term implications. Based on our research, there is clear need for a set of criteria against which to weigh not just the medical issues, but also definitive patient-centred issues when considering a lower extremity amputation. We offer a set of patient-centred, easily verified and recognised criteria that we believe addresses this need. The goal of the Miller-Newgent Amputation Scale (MENACE) is to provide a decision base from which to consider and evaluate all factors in determining the need for a lower extremity amputation. This involves identification of patient-centred issues, which are likely to produce satisfactory short- and long-term physical and quality-of-life outcomes if the amputation does proceed.
